Formed in 1959 following the construction of Xin'an River Reservoir, it is China's largest National Forest Park. It has a total of 1,078 islets, each with its own formation. In recent years, Qian Dao Hu has developed over twenty travel sites, which may be divided into four types: nature, wild life, historic sites, and entertainment. In the middle of the lake, an islet in the shape of a plant blossom is famed for its beautiful natural scenery and perfect environment and also regarded as the best place to view the surrounding landscape. Here, one can also see many wild animals such as swans, mandarin ducks, mandarins, and bitterns. Those who have rich interest in wild animals can continue to appreciate the animal show or go to feed ostriches in Ostrich Islet and take photos with them, even ride on an ostrich's back if they're brave enough. In addition, various traditional activities are offered there. Different seasons have different activities: Muju (local drama) in the spring, Dragon Lantern show in the fall, Tiao Zhu Ma (local dancing party) in the summer may be visitors' favorites.
Qian Dao Hu has been honorably awarded the titles like "National Model County Town of Cleanness", "China's Excellent Scenic Spot " and "National Model Town of Ecological Environment" as the biggest lake in China.
